You asked: How do I optimize my Android tablet?

Optimize your tablet so it always runs at its best. To improve your tablet’s performance, navigate to Settings. Tap Device care, and then tap Optimize now. When the optimization is complete, review what’s been optimized, and then tap Done.

Why is my tablet so slow now?

The cache on your Samsung tablet is designed to make things run smoothly. But over time, it can become bloated and cause slowdown. Clear out the cache of individual apps in the App Menu or click Settings > Storage > Cached data to clean all app caches with one tap.

How do I clean up my tablet?

How to clear the cache on your Android tablet apps

  1. On your tablet’s home screen, tap the “Settings” button.
  2. Tap “Storage.”
  3. In the “Storage” menu, tap either “Internal Storage” or “Other Apps” depending on your device.
  4. Find the application you want to clear the cache of and tap it.
  5. Tap “Clear cache.”

Can you defrag a tablet?

Android devices should not be defragmented. Defragmenting an Android device will not lead to any performance gains, as flash memory is not affected by fragmentation. Defragmenting a flash drive (like the one Android devices use) will actually shorten its lifespan.

How do I clear the cache on a tablet?

In the Chrome app

  1. On your Android phone or tablet, open the Chrome app .
  2. At the top right, tap More .
  3. Tap History. Clear browsing data.
  4. At the top, choose a time range. To delete everything, select All time.
  5. Next to “Cookies and site data” and “Cached images and files,” check the boxes.
  6. Tap Clear data.
